Local Government Byelaws (Wales) Act 2012

21Orders and regulations

(1)A power to make an order or regulations under this Act (apart from an order under section 22 (commencement)) includes power to make such incidental, consequential, transitional or supplemental provision as the Welsh Ministers consider appropriate.

(2)In the case of the power under sections 9 and 16, this provision includes provision amending, repealing or revoking enactments.

(3)Any power of the Welsh Ministers to make an order or regulations under this Act is exercisable by statutory instrument.

(4)A statutory instrument containing an order under section 9, 13(5) or 16 may not be made unless a draft of the instrument has been laid before, and approved by a resolution of, the National Assembly for Wales.

(5)Any other statutory instrument containing an order or regulations under this Act, apart from an instrument containing only an order under section 22 (commencement), is subject to annulment in pursuance of a resolution of the National Assembly for Wales.
